Yeah .. what I meant was ip address to be zero ( not the port ). Setting the ip 
address as zero is not a standard solution but still you can still find it is 
used widely. By setting the ip address to zero, bascially you will not be 
getting the RTCP packets from the phoneB. Going by the philosophy "Be strict 
while delivering, but liberal while accepting", a=sendonly *should* be well 
enough to put phoneB on hold.
(phoneB *must* also support RFC 3264). You may need not set the ip address to 
0.0.0.0.
 
a=inactive is used when both the parties prefer not to send media and thus 
making the media inactive.

        Dear Experts,
                Caller sends INVITE with media port as 1000 to callee. ie 
caller says to the callee, am listening in 1000. callee sends 200 OK with media 
port as 2000. ie callee set the caller's ip and port(1000) and it says am 
listening in 2000. after getting ACK, both ways RTP is going successfully. 
         
        now when doing call onhold, media port shold be incremented to 1002 or 
same 1000?
         
        please tell me the standard.
